Common InteractiveBootstrapCheck.exe Errors on Windows

Dealing with InteractiveBootstrapCheck.exe errors can often be perplexing, given the variety of issues that might cause them. They can range from a mere software glitch to a more serious malware intrusion. Here, we've compiled a list of the most common errors associated with InteractiveBootstrapCheck.exe to help you navigate and possibly fix these issues.

  • InteractiveBootstrapCheck.exe has Stopped Working: This warning is displayed when the system detects that the executable file is no longer performing as expected. This can be caused by software errors, interference from other applications, or system resource limitations.
  • Blue Screen of Death (BSOD): Although not strictly an InteractiveBootstrapCheck.exe error, certain .exe files can cause system instability leading to a BSOD, indicating a fatal system error.
  • InteractiveBootstrapCheck.exe - Bad Image Error:: This error message indicates that Windows cannot run InteractiveBootstrapCheck.exe because it's either corrupted, or the associated DLL file is missing or corrupted.
  • Unable to Start Correctly (0xc000007b): This warning is shown when the application fails to start as it should, typically caused by an inconsistency between the 32-bit and 64-bit versions of the application and the Windows operating system.
  • Error 0xc0000142: This warning surfaces when there's an issue with an application starting up correctly. This might be due to issues within the application, corruption of related files, or problems associated with the Windows registry.

Step 1: Open System Restore

Step 1: Open System Restore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type System Restore in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Click on Create a restore point.

Step 2: Choose a Restore Point

Step 2: Choose a Restore Point Thumbnail
  1. In the System Properties window, under the System Protection tab, click on System Restore....

  2. Click Next in the System Restore window.

  3. Choose a restore point from the list. Ideally, select a point when you know the system was working well.

Step 3: Start the Restore Process

Step 3: Start the Restore Process Thumbnail
  1. Click Next, then Finish to start the restore process.

Step 4: Restart Your Computer

Step 4: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. Once the restore process is complete, restart your computer.

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the restart, check if the InteractiveBootstrapCheck.exe problem persists.
